Weighing in at about 100kg’s I built a 6’6", it’s fine. It’s NOT a speed dialer though. I don’t know enough about that type of board but a “regular” fish can be built quite large.
For a board with more volume, around 17x22x16.75 is a good place to start. For a ‘racier’ quad, try 16x21x16.5 with a wing behind each fin, pulling in the swallows to about 9" pin to pin. Depends on your size, waves, etc. Don’t be afraid to tweak your planshape behind the last wing (i.e.–pull it in more).
